The image “http://www.hometheaterblog.com/hometheater/images/dvd-case.jpg” cannot be displayed, because it contains errors.Recently I was given a chance to try out a new service that Netflix is offering, one that allows you to watch movies right in your browser (ONLY IE6+). While this service is great, it is really hard watching a movie on your computer as you feel lagged after a while. Today we will be looking at the Matrix. The first part of watching movies is to download some Netflix software, so just download that and IE is ready to go. You choose a movie, it even gives you a movie that is available that is currently in your queue. Loading was rather quick on an average modem, so no special high speed connection necessary, and basically you just watch it. A nice little secret they don’t tell you is it supports keyboard shortcuts, probably because it is a front-end for Windows Media Player, so all the basic controls such as SPACE(Play/Pause) and ESC(to exit full screen) work here, so that’s nice. As for the interface, well it is really simplistic and essentially just a bar that has a play/pause button, a full screen button and a slider. The quality of the film is auto-adjusted based on your connection speed. Mine is okay, but don’t be surprised if you have a 30 inch screen and it looks really bad.
